What is Chiropractic CE Application

The Chiropractic Continuing Education Application is an application form used by organizations or schools to obtain approval for continuing education courses aimed at chiropractors.

Key Features of the Chiropractic Continuing Education Application

The application form includes several essential elements that provide necessary details regarding the course. Key fields include:
  • Course name
  • Contact information for the provider
  • Dates and locations of the course
  • Educational format (online, in-person, etc.)
  • Instructor qualifications and experience
Additionally, the form requires certifications and signatures to ensure compliance with educational standards.

Eligibility to submit the Chiropractic Continuing Education Application typically includes organizations or schools offering chiropractic courses. Individual instructors may also submit applications if they represent an accredited institution.
The application must be submitted with required attachments including the course syllabus, vitae of instructors, and promotional materials that detail the course's content and objectives.
While the specific deadlines may vary by organization, it is advisable to submit the Chiropractic Continuing Education Application well in advance of the course start date to allow adequate review time.
The application can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ller where you can complete and save your form, or as a printed copy, depending on the requirements set forth by the accreditation agency.
Common mistakes include incomplete sections or missing signatures. Always ensure that all fields are filled in accurately and validate that the certification statement is signed before submission.
Processing times fluctuate depending on the institution’s workload. Typically, you can expect feedback or approval notifications within 4-6 weeks, but it's best to check specific turnaround times with the accrediting body.
No, notarization is not required for the Chiropractic Continuing Education Application. Ensure all parts are truthfully filled and signed by the applicant instead.
